No carnival is complete without a collection of fun and interactive carnival games. These are the heart of your event and set the tone for lively competition and laughter. From DIY ring tosses to bean bag throws and duck pond fishing, you can either purchase ready-made kits or create your own with minimal supplies.
Ring Toss (using glass bottles or cones)
Bean Bag Toss (painted plywood boards work great)
Duck Pond (use kiddie pools and numbered rubber ducks)
Balloon Darts (with safety in mind—use magnetic darts for kids)
Games are easy to scale for all ages, making them perfect for kids and entertaining for adults too.

Nothing smells more like a carnival than the buttery aroma of fresh popcorn. A popcorn machine brings an authentic touch while serving up hot, crunchy snacks that guests of all ages will love. These machines are easy to operate, and many come in tabletop or vintage-style designs that double as décor.
Offer fun seasoning options like cheese, caramel, or spicy blends.
Provide striped popcorn bags or cones for that nostalgic feel.
Place your popcorn station near game booths for maximum aroma attraction.

Carnival tickets are more than just decorative—they add structure and immersion to your event. Use them for game access, food items, or raffles. Not only does this create a realistic carnival vibe, but it also helps regulate traffic and supplies.
Give guests a set number upon entry.
Offer a ticket redemption booth for prizes.
Design custom-branded tickets for your event.
Printable ticket rolls or vibrant tear-off pads are available online and add instant charm.

Setting up booths and stalls adds authenticity and structure to your carnival layout. Each station can serve a unique purpose—games, food, drinks, prizes, and more. You can DIY these using PVC frames, foldable tables, or pop-up tents with themed signage and coverings.
“Test Your Aim” for games
“Sweet Treats” for snacks
“Ticket Exchange” for prizes
“Face Paint Station” for kids
Decorate with matching tablecloths, balloons, and signage to enhance the ambiance.

Now that you know the top 10 essentials, here are some bonus ideas to help your backyard carnival be smooth and sensational:
Always have a backup plan for rain or excessive sun. Tents, umbrellas, and shaded areas help keep things comfortable.
Keep things clean and kid-friendly with hand sanitizers, wipes, and trash bins throughout the event.
Create a timeline for different activities, especially if you’re including contests or performances.
Offer parting goodie bags with snacks, toys, and photo prints for lasting memories.
